Abstract:
A vehicle seat arrangement is provided for a working vehicle comprising an operator's seat (10, 60) having an adjustable feature. A first control element (32) is arranged such that a first work operative position is defined. A seat adjusting element (34) is further provided for enabling the operator to set the adjustable feature of the operator's seat. The seat adjusting element is positioned relative to the first control element such that the operator may selectively control the adjustable feature of the seat without significantly interrupting the first work operative position or without significantly interrupting a transition from a first task to a second task and/or from a first work operative position to a second work operative position.
Abstract:
A lift truck (10) is provided comprising: a power unit assembly (20) comprising a power unit base (21), a wheel (23) coupled to the base, and a system for driving the wheel; and a main frame assembly (30) detachably connected to the power unit assembly. The main frame assembly comprises a main frame base (31), a mast assembly (32) coupled to the main frame base, a carriage assembly (34) coupled to the mast assembly, and hydraulic drive apparatus (80) coupled to the mast assembly. Preferably, substantially the entirety of the hydraulic drive apparatus is provided on the main frame assembly such that the main frame assembly is detachable from the power unit assembly without requiring disconnecting hydraulic connections to the power unit assembly.
Abstract:
Seat repositioning systems for vehicles comprise a seat release element (104) that is operable to cause an operator's seat (32) to be temporarily released from a locked position such that the operator's seat may be adjusted to a new position. By optionally positioning the seat release element proximate to an operator's working position, a vehicle operator may reposition the seat while simultaneously performing another task. Moreover, a control module (152) may be provided that is capable of deciding whether or not to allow the operator's seat to be released based upon vehicle parameters such as vehicle speed or load handling conditions. Still further, the control module may temporarily disable select features of the vehicle depending upon the position of the seat.
Abstract:
An operator’s seat (32) for a vehicle (10) includes a base structure (46) that allows the operator’s seat to be rotated with respect to a platform floor (31) of an operator’s compartment (30) within the vehicle. The operator’s seat may further include a swivel structure (87) that allows an operator support (48) to swivel independently of the rotation of the base structure. At least one presence sensing device (98) may be provided to detect the presence of an operator. The presence sensing device(s), and rotational position of the operator support may provide input signals to a control module (106, 152, 156, 158, 160, 162) that controls the vehicle travel, load handling features, and/or other features of the vehicle that may be selectively enabled, limited or otherwise controlled.
